History of PSG
Formation and Early Years
PG was founded in 1970 through the merger of Paris FC and Stade Saint-Germain. Unlike many European giants, PG does not have a century-old legacy, but its rapid rise makes it one of football’s most fascinating success stories.
In the early years, PG struggled for stability but quickly gained popularity in Paris.

The Qatar Era: A Turning Point
In 2011, PG was taken over by Qatar Sports Investments, marking a major transformation.
Impact of the Takeover
- Massive financial investment
- Global brand expansion
- Signing world-class players
This era turned PG into a European superclub.

PSG in European Competitions
UEFA Champions League Journey
PG’s biggest goal has been winning the UEFA Champions League.
The club reached the final in 2020 but fell short. Despite heavy investment, European glory remains elusive.

Rivalries
Le Classique
PG’s biggest rivalry is with Olympique de Marseille.
This match is known as “Le Classique” and is the most intense fixture in French football.

Financial Power and Transfers
PG is known for big-money signings:
- Neymar (€222 million)
- Mbappé (€180 million)
The club’s financial strength allows it to compete with giants like Real Madrid and Manchester City.
